Recaf java
TīmeklisRecaf 3X: Solving a simple Java crackme with SSVM. Matt Coley. 45 subscribers. Subscribe. 1.1K views 8 months ago. A quick demo of using SSVM integration in … TīmeklisRecaf lets you edit the file in a variety of ways. Firstly is recompiling decompiled code. The key difference is that Recaf will manage compiler dependencies for you. Drop in your file, add your libraries and make your changes. One Control + S and exporting the modified file later you're done. But what if you don't have access to all the libraries?
Recaf java
Did you know?
Tīmeklis2024. gada 7. marts · The compiled Java bytecode can be easily reversed engineered back into source code by a freely available decompilers. Bytecode Obfuscation is the process of modifying Java bytecode (executable or library) so that it is much harder to read and understand for a hacker but remains fully functional. Almost all code can be … Tīmeklis2010. gada 7. janv. · Recaf4Forge Inspired by Luyten4Forge What is this? This is a plugin for Recaf which can automatically detects a Minecraft Forge Mods version using the mcmod.info and applies the correct mapping. It also allows you to export the Forge MDK for the version. The mappings and mdks are stored in this jar file, so you don't …
Tīmeklis2024. gada 17. febr. · The most effective and simple tool we found for bytecode editing was ReCaf. It has a graphical user interface that handles importing JAR files, decompiling to source, modifying byte code, and repacking the JAR file. It additionally includes some Java magic that allows you to make more changes compared to JBE … TīmeklisRecaf . An easy to use modern Java bytecode editor that abstracts away the complexities of Java programs. Recaf abstracts away: Constant pool; Stack frames; …
Tīmeklis2024. gada 12. sept. · I develop Recaf, a free Java bytecode editor. Recaf currently supports most of what you're looking for in the current release (Decompile via CFR, class/member renaming, a verbose search feature, and contextual actions on the decompiled code). Right now it's going through a rewrite which will include even … TīmeklisI'm new to Java and working on cleaning up a fairly large Java .jar sample where the obfuscator has renamed symbols into invalid names. For example: import org.lib.00.0.2; public final class 90 ... Using Recaf I am renaming these symbols that are using numbers but after doing so Recaf isn't able to find the renamed classes/packages …
Tīmeklis2024. gada 26. dec. · The java compiler will usually inline references to static final fields at compile time. So even if you change the value of the field, it won't actually affect …
Tīmeklis2024. gada 19. nov. · It is best if you report Recaf issues on the Recaf github page, not a 3rd party platform You can still edit but the recompilation feature is disabled due to the inability to find the local Java compiler. Most of Recaf is based on the assembler, which you can find documentation on here: "Class editing modes" is a hp laptop a windowTīmeklis* Launch Recaf */ private static void launch ( String [] args) { // Setup initializer, this loads command line arguments Initializer initializer = new Initializer (); CommandLine … is a hp laptop a window laptopTīmeklisgradle/ wrapper src/main/java/me/xdark/ antiantidebug .gitignore LICENSE README.md build.gradle gradlew gradlew.bat settings.gradle README.md AntiAntiDebug This plugin has only one job: hide Recaf from 'anti tampers'. is a hp laptop mac or windowsTīmeklisif ( Recaf. class. getClassLoader () == ClassLoader. getSystemClassLoader ()) { warn ( "Recaf was attached and loaded into system class loader," + " that is not a good thing!" ); } init (); VMUtil. patchInstrumentation ( inst ); // Log that we are an agent info ( "Starting as agent..." ); // Add instrument launch arg oleanders growthTīmeklisRecaf imports the following libraries from the JDK: /lib/tools.jar - compiler, instrumentation /lib/sa-jdi.jar - debugging These libraries should be automatically discovered by Recaf if they are in the expected directories. You can validate the libraries are loaded by checking the "System information" window, located in the "Help" menu. is a hp chromebook windows compatibleTīmeklisThe Recaf compiler generically transforms an extended version of Java, into code that builds up the desired semantics. Hence, Recaf is lightweight: the programmer can … is a hp computer good for gamingTīmeklisSimply open the class, make your changes as plain Java code, and save. Requirements Configuring compiler support To edit decompiled code you must make sure that you … oleander sharpshooter resistant